Children’s BBC in Glasgow has put out a call for adults, and children, aged between 9-13 years, to join its studio audience for a new series of the children's game show Copycats.

The show, hosted by Sam and Mark, will feature a mix of mimes, drawing and musical cubical games, with new challenges facing the contestants as the two teams compete head-to-head. Copycats is being made by the same department that is responsible for CBBC shows such as Raven, Get 100, Wait for It, Stakeout, and Ed and Oucho’s Excellent Inventions.

The show is being shot in June at Studio A at Pacific Quay, during term time, and in July, during the summer holidays.

Recording dates are 7th – 11th, and 14th – 18th of June and 6th – 8th, 13th – 15th, and 20th – 22nd of July 2010.
